This is the island that brought me to Grapeview 25 years ago.  Being connected by bridge to the mainland, there is no ferry wait.  Surrounded by Case Inlet, it is the perfect place to own a waterski boat as the children grow up on the beaches.  It was rural claiming Washington's first bonded winery and the uplands contained many vineyards.  I enjoyed living on the island and bought 5 acres on the waterfront.  My company, SchonWood, Inc., produced thousands of sleds for Eddie Bauer catalog sales.

These sled were built by us in the Olde St. Charles Winery on Stretch Island.  Long hours were put in with the cutting, sanding, design work, and varnishing.  The sled on the right was sold in the Eddie Bauer Christmas catalog.  We made about 1800 of them and hauled them to the Seattle warehouse.
